ANDALUCÍA
The IPC rises by 3.8% year-on-year in January in Andalusia and food rises to 7.6%: {Translation, summary}
– The Consumer Price Index (CPI) {Índice de Precios de Consumo (IPC)} rose by 3.8% year-on-year in Andalusia in January, five tenths of a percentage point higher than the year-on-year rate of the previous month (3.3%), according to data published on Thursday by the National Statistics Institute (INE).
– With January’s rise, the year-on-year rate once again increased in the region after having fallen the previous month. In monthly terms, inflation in Andalusia increased by 0.1%, while so far this year the rise has reached 0.1%.
– For its part, the price of food increased again to 7.6%, which is four tenths of a percentage point more than in the previous month, when food prices rose by 7.2%.
– In year-on-year terms, the Andalusian rate of 3.8% is higher than the national rate, which stands at 3.4%, and lower than the Canary Islands, with 4%. While Galicia has registered the same rate as Andalusia (3.8%).
– Prices exceeded the previous year’s level in all categories, the highest being food and non-alcoholic beverages, 7.6% more than in January 2023 (+0.4 points with respect to the year-on-year rate recorded the previous month); restaurants and hotels, 5.6% (-0.1 points); alcoholic beverages and tobacco, 4.1% (+0.4 points) and housing, water, electricity, gas and other fuels, 3.1% (+9.4 points).
– Meanwhile, where the year-on-year rises are more moderate is in transport, up 0.5% (-3.7 points); communications, up 0.6% (-2.5 points); furniture, household goods and articles for the current maintenance of the home, up 1.3% (-0.1 points) and clothing and footwear, up 2.3% (+1.3 points).
*INFLATION IN ANDALUSIA BY PROVINCE*
– By provinces, where prices have risen the most in the last year was in Cordoba (4.2% with a monthly increase of 0.1%), followed by Malaga, Seville and Granada, with 3.8%, respectively, where Seville experienced a monthly increase of 0.3%, Malaga recorded no change, and Granada fell by -0.1% compared to the previous month; Almeria and Huelva, both with 3.7% and a monthly increase of 0.1% for the latter. This was followed by Cádiz (3.6%, unchanged from the previous month), and lastly, Jaén (3.5%, up 0.1% from December). ESTEPONA
Oooops, building collapsed during the excavation of an external trench:
– The Souvenirs Estepona shop, on Avenida de España at the junction with the centrally located Calle San Nicolás, has collapsed this Wednesday afternoon (14 February) “after the building’s foundations were breached by 20 centimetres” during external work being carried out by workers from European Engineering, Works and Technology, a subcontractor of water company Hidralia.
– The work was planned as part of the municipal plan to improve the sewage system network. No personal injuries were reported after the incident.

UK
What being in recession means and how it happened to the UK:
– Prime Minister Rishi Sunak’s pledge to grow the economy has been dealt a hammer blow after official figures revealed Britain fell into recession at the end of last year.
– The Office for National Statistics (ONS) estimated that gross domestic product (GDP) fell by a worse-than-expected 0.3% between October and December, following a decline of 0.1% in the previous three months. It means that the economy entered a technical recession, as defined by two or more quarters in a row of falling GDP.
– Shadow chancellor Rachel Reeves said: “The Prime Minister can no longer credibly claim that his plan is working or that he has turned the corner on more than 14 years of economic decline under the Conservatives that has left Britain worse off. “This is Rishi Sunak’s recession and the news will be deeply worrying for families and business across Britain.” Full article: https://www.independent.co.uk/news/business/what-does-being-in-recession-mean-b2496633.html

Julian Assange- Australia wants WikiLeaks founder back home:
– Australian Prime Minister Anthony Albanese on Thursday called for the release of Julian Assange of legal pursuit by US and UK authorities. The 52-year-old WikiLeaks founder, who is an Australian citizen, has been trapped in legal limbo for years after releasing a raft of top secret US documents on war in Iraq and Afghanistan in 2010. He is currently being held in London but is facing extradition to the US on charges of espionage.
“People will have a range of views about Mr. Assange’s conduct,” Albanese told parliament. “But regardless of where people stand, this thing cannot just go on and on and on indefinitely.”
– The WikiLeaks founder will head to the UK’s High Court of Justice next week in an attempt to appeal his extradition.
– On Wednesday, the Australian parliament passed a motion calling for Assange to be returned to his home country. The motion had been put forward by independent Australian lawmaker Andrew Wilkie and supported by the prime minister. The motion called on the US and UK to bring the “matter to a close so that Mr. Assange can return home to his family in Australia.”
– Assange’s brother Gabriel Shipton welcomed the motion which came “at a crucial time,” saying that the free speech activist could be extradited to the US as soon as next week. “That means all the ties to his family, his lifeline that are keeping him alive inside that prison will be cut off and he’ll be lost into a horrific prison system in the United States,” Shipton said.
